I do most of my work in a Mac and Linux environment and use Textmate™ as my primary editor/IDE. If you haven’t heard of or used Textmate before I can’t recommend it enough. Unfortunately it is only available for the Mac OS X operating system. If you run linux I suggest either vi or vim as great editors. There is also a great free editor with a nice looking GTK/GUI called BlueFish which I like and use a lot.
